California Stronger Connections webinar series

The California Stronger Connections Technical Assistance Center (SCTAC) encourages collaboration between California local education agencies (LEAs) and their communities to foster safe, healthy, and supportive learning environments. 

WestEd, in partnership with the California Department of Education (CDE), is hosting several free virtual events to support SCTAC goals.

  • Beyond Self-Care: Creating Supportive Conditions for Staff Well-Being
    Date:
    June 18, 2026
    Description: Supporting staff well-being in schools requires more than encouraging individual self-care; it calls for intentional practices, supportive conditions, and a culture of collective care. In this session, participants will explore practical strategies schools and districts can use to support adult well-being, strengthen connection, and create more restorative work environments. Participants will also hear from a school Principal about how staff well-being efforts have made a meaningful difference in her school community, including the role of a dedicated staff wellness space. The webinar will offer practical strategies and resources that educators and leaders can adapt to help create healthier, more supportive conditions for staff across a school community.

  • Wellness Mini-Session: Mindfulness & Creativity with Neurographic Art
    Date: September 9, 2026
    Description: Webinar | In this workshop, you will explore Neurographic Art, a meditative drawing process that transforms stress into calm through simple, flowing lines and organic shapes. Unlike traditional art, Neurographic Art focuses entirely on the process of creation rather than a final masterpiece.

  • Attendance and Connections Network for Local Education Agencies
    Date: 5 Sessions Beginning September 29, 2026
    All local education agencies in California are invited to join a cohort of peers working to improve school climate through participatory data use practices. Through a 5-part series of interactive sessions, teams of 2-3 will engage in peer learning to explore effective approaches for collecting and analyzing school climate data in partnership with community members, and identify meaningful metrics and data routines that effectively capture the essence of belonging, connection, and engagement within the school community.
